Overview

Embedded steel waterstop is a specialized construction component designed to seal joints in concrete structures, preventing water infiltration. It is commonly used in underground constructions, water treatment plants, and hydraulic engineering projects where watertightness is critical. The material is typically made from stainless steel or galvanized steel, offering durability and resistance to environmental factors like moisture and chemical exposure. Its design ensures seamless integration into concrete pours, forming a permanent barrier against leaks.

Structure and Working Principle

The waterstop consists of a flat or ribbed steel strip, often with a central "bulb" to enhance flexibility and sealing performance. During installation, it is embedded across concrete joints, with half placed in the first pour and the remaining half in the subsequent pour. When concrete sets, the steel strip acts as a physical barrier, blocking water migration through the joint. Its rigidity prevents displacement during curing, while corrosion-resistant coatings ensure long-term functionality even in aggressive environments.

Key Features

Embedded steel waterstops boast high tensile strength, ensuring structural integrity under hydrostatic pressure. Their non-permeable nature makes them ideal for permanent water containment systems. Unlike rubber or PVC alternatives, steel waterstops withstand extreme temperatures and mechanical stress, making them suitable for heavy-duty applications. Some variants include flanges or perforations to improve bonding with concrete.

Application Areas

Primary applications include basement walls, tunnel linings, sewage treatment plants, and reservoir constructions. They are also used in bridge abutments and dam expansions where joint movement is minimal. In seismic zones, specialized flexible steel waterstops accommodate minor shifts without compromising the seal. Their use is mandated in many national building codes for below-grade waterproofing systems.

Maintenance and Precautions

Proper installation is critical: misalignment can create leakage paths. Workers must ensure the waterstop is clean, undamaged, and securely fixed before concrete placement. Avoid welding on-site unless using certified methods, as heat can weaken the material. Inspect for rust or damage during storage, and protect edges during handling to prevent deformation.

B2B Procurement Guide

When sourcing embedded steel waterstops, verify compliance with standards like ASTM or BS EN. Request mill test certificates for material quality assurance. Consider project-specific factors: thickness (typically 1–3 mm), width (200–400 mm), and coating type. Bulk orders may qualify for discounts, but ensure proper storage to prevent pre-installation corrosion. Lead times vary based on customization needs.
